The Winter Garden Rotary Club hosted its first community dance at Tanner Hall on Friday, Jan. 19, and about 150 club members and West Orange residents were in attendance. They were treated to an evening of food and drinks, a raffle and hours of dancing music.
The event was such a success that the club plans to make it an annual event.
Approximately $2,500 was raised, thanks to the raffle gifts donated by Ace Hardware, Main Street Mower, Ms. Bee’s Popcorn and West Orange Country Club, as well as several guests. The proceeds will be donated to a local charity.
